Tennessee Adventure Trip


Hello loves, hope you are all doing well! I recently went on a trip to Tennessee with a bunch of other college students, and it was one of the best experiences I have ever had! 

I have been itching to travel, explore new places, and do new things out of my comfort zone, so when I saw this trip as an option on the website of my university's outdoor recreation center, I decided right then and there that I had to do it. The trip involved a ten hour roadtrip in a van, camping in 30 degree weather, hiking, camping, rock climbing, and bouldering! Seeing as I had never done any of those, except for riding in a car for ten hours, I thought this would be a great way to ease myself into traveling "semi-solo" (aka without my family).
